Tune of the Day: She’s In Parties – Fallen


London quartet She’s In Parties keep proving why they’re one of the UK’s most vital new indie bands, and their latest single Fallen seals it. A slow-burn piano intro gives way to a soaring, anthemic chorus and a blistering guitar solo — a track that feels both cathartic and life-affirming.


Frontwoman Katie Dillon describes it as “an ode to myself” — a reminder to shake off those moments of self-pity and recognise the good around you. That mix of vulnerability and uplift is exactly why Fallen lands so hard: it’s intimate yet stadium-sized, delicate yet powerful.


With two acclaimed EPs already under their belt and a new one, Are You Dreaming?, arriving on November 7th via Submarine Cat (vinyl pre-orders open now), She’s In Parties are pushing their shoegaze-drenched indie-pop into exhilarating new territory.
